Jenna bought 5 reams of paper at the store for a total of $21 . The tax on her purchase was $1 . Write a equation and solve to find the price of each ream of paper

Answer:The equation needed is [tex]\textrm{Cost of 1 ream of paper} = \frac{20}{5} [/tex]The cost per ream of paper = $4Step-by-step explanation:Here, the cost of 5 reams of paper = $ 21The tax on her purchase = $1So, the actual cost of 5 reams of paper = Total Cost paid - Tax amount = $ 21 - $ 1 = $20So, the actual cost of 5 reams of the paper is $20.Now, to find out the cost of 1 ream of paper:[tex]\textrm{Cost of 1 ream of paper} = \frac{\textrm{Total amount paid for 5 reams}}{\textrm{ 5}} \\= \frac{20}{5} = 4[/tex]= $4Hence, the cost of each ream of paper = $ 4.
